Wedding traditions are the customs, rituals, and symbolic practices passed down through generations that give a marriage ceremony its cultural identity and deeper meaning. From the breaking of glass in Jewish ceremonies to the vibrant mehndi designs adorning an Indian bride’s hands, these time-honored practices connect couples to their heritage while celebrating the universal joy of commitment.
